This is not an issue I need to resolve. I agree with Mr. Gupta and Ms. Gaunt that as is said at paragraph 22 of their Position Statement the above means B has either (i) received a consistent message from both parents that she may (if not will) be returning to Portugal in which case she will understand her current situation is or may be a temporary one; or (ii) she has received different messages from each of her parents, in which case she is likely to feel a sense of confusion. Either way, B has not received a clear and consistent message that this country is and will be her permanent home. I agree that B will therefore feel ‘in limbo’ and in my view cannot as a consequence have a sense of physical, psychological and emotional settlement here (as distinct from her feeling settled with M). My analysis in this regard is similar to that of Ms. Veitch as expressed at paragraphs 50 and 51 of her report.
